Engineering on EC 5.4.99.45 - tRNA pseudouridine38/39 synthase

additional information
the thermosensitive growth phenotype of deg1 mutants is specifically suppressible by overexpression of tRNAGln UUG but not tRNAGln CUG or any other tRNA carrying U38 or U39, which is modified by Deg1 to Psi, with clear suppression of deg1-induced thermosensitivity by multicopy tRNAGln UUG but not tRNAGln CUG or other tester tRNAs. Rescue by multicopy tRNAGln UUG is clearly incomplete as growth at 39°C is not fully restored to wild-type levels. Negative genetic interactions between DEG1, Elongator and URM1 can be extended to conditions of TORC1 inhibition, rapamycin sensitivity of deg1, urm1 and elp3 single and all possible double mutant combinations, overview. Deletion of the DEG1 gene in strain W303-1B and score of adenine auxotrophy as well as color colony in direct comparison with an elp3 mutant that is known to affect SUP4-mediated read-through
